InboxDollars availability in Brazil

InboxDollars, a popular rewards platform in the United States, has garnered interest from international users, particularly those in Brazil. However, as of the latest information, InboxDollars is not officially available in Brazil. The platform’s services are primarily restricted to U.S. residents, with payments and rewards structured around U.S. currency and payment methods like PayPal or checks. Brazilian users attempting to sign up may encounter geolocation restrictions or incompatibility with local payment systems, making participation impractical.

For Brazilians seeking alternatives, several local and international platforms offer similar opportunities. Sites like Toluna, Mobrog, and Ysense are accessible in Brazil and provide surveys, tasks, or offers in exchange for rewards. These platforms often support local payment methods, such as PicPay or bank transfers, making them more viable options. Additionally, Brazilian-specific apps like MeSeems and Opiniões cater directly to the local market, offering surveys and tasks in Portuguese and rewards tailored to Brazilian users.

One key factor limiting InboxDollars’ availability in Brazil is the platform’s reliance on U.S.-centric partnerships and advertisers. Expanding to Brazil would require significant adjustments, including localizing content, partnering with Brazilian brands, and integrating regional payment systems. While InboxDollars has not announced plans for international expansion, similar platforms have successfully entered the Brazilian market by addressing these challenges, proving there is demand for such services.
